Output 83c66e1fecf7b45b42d93149b4a9e6b9a3687f74b458b646bed44feee99a8924:1

value
35607000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62aa174ca191b49599b9d53dcc9fbe92fea4abc4 OP_EQUAL
address
MGtrDMrSbzrtE9C3CMHpn4CWuUo4aoxPns
transaction
83c66e1fecf7b45b42d93149b4a9e6b9a3687f74b458b646bed44feee99a8924
spent
true